Water Cycle Ocean. at its most basic, the water cycle is how water continuously moves from the ground to the atmosphere and back again. importance of the ocean in the water cycle. the oceans are, by far, the largest storehouse of water on earth — over 96% of all of earth's water exists in the. the water cycle describes how water is exchanged (cycled) through earth's land, ocean, and atmosphere. the water cycle is the endless process that connects all of that water. in its three phases (solid, liquid, and gas), water ties together the major parts of the earth’s climate system — air, clouds, the ocean, lakes, vegetation, snowpack, and glaciers. It joins earth’s oceans, land, and atmosphere. The water cycle shows the continuous movement of water within the earth and atmosphere. Water always exists in all three. The ocean plays a key role in this vital cycle of water. The ocean holds 97% of the total water on the planet;
